Approaching Acute Vertigo With Diplopia: A Rare Skew Deviation in Vestibular Neuritis
Scott D Z Eggers1, Jorge C Kattah2
1Department of Neurology, Mayo Clinic, Rochester, MN.
Clinicians can accurately diagnose acute vertigo and diplopia by understanding key examination findings. This case highlights vestibular neuritis as a cause of skew deviation, emphasizing bedside testing over imaging.

Background:
- Acute vertigo and diplopia present diagnostic challenges, potentially indicating serious conditions like stroke.
- Distinguishing dangerous from benign causes requires careful symptom and sign interpretation.
Observation:
- Presents a case of acute vertigo and binocular diplopia caused by skew deviation secondary to vestibular neuritis.
- Utilizes text and video commentary to guide clinicians through history, bedside examination, and laboratory evaluation.
Findings:
- Demonstrates interpretation of nystagmus and proper performance of the head impulse test and test of skew deviation.
- Highlights the importance of clinical examination in diagnosing acute vestibular syndrome.
Implications:
- Emphasizes accurate bedside diagnostic skills for acute vestibular syndrome.
- Warns against overreliance on imaging in vertigo evaluation, promoting a systematic clinical approach.
- Provides a valuable learning resource for clinicians managing patients with acute vertigo and diplopia.
